Frequently Asked Questions about Phoenix
How much are Studio apartments in Phoenix?
There are currently 1,458 Studio Apartments in Phoenix with rent ranges from $599 to $4,705 with an average price of $1,331.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Phoenix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Phoenix ranges from $526 to $25,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,558.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Phoenix c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Phoenix range from $644 to $15,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,907.
How expensive are Phoenix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,238 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Phoenix on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$730 to $19,995 - averaging $2,486 for the location.
